Minutes — Management Meeting, Tornquist Group

Present: Hale, Ubbens, Carreno. Topic: training budget, next fiscal year.

Agreed: total envelope frozen at current-year level. Leadership programme at the Dunmere campus cut by a third; funds redirected to technical certification for the Fennick product line. Ubbens to draft allocations by branch within two weeks. Carreno flagged supplier renegotiation as a savings source. All items approved without dissent. Strategic rationale for the board is appended below.

internal memo for faweg-tafog: Only 7 of the 100 pilot accounts renewed Quenael, so a churn review is set for April 15.

**Vendor note: Inkmill markdown pipeline**

Rendering for Parchway docs is outsourced to Inkmill under an annual contract, renewing each March. They handle sanitization and PDF export; we own the upload queue. SLA: 4-hour response on rendering failures. Escalate only after two failed retries. Their support desk is reachable at the address below.

billing contact of hahaf-baguf = zorael.tammir.jorius@sivrelhq.internal

## TurnstileCount Basics

Support quick-start for the Grandmere Arena turnstile counter. Each gate posts tallies every 30 seconds. Missed intervals backfill automatically within five minutes — don't escalate unless a gate is silent longer than that. Common ticket: counts frozen on the lobby display. Fix: restart the display agent, not the gate firmware. Gate firmware restarts require venue ops approval. All tallies, gate status, and backfill logs sit in the counts database. The read-only support account connects with the string below.

primary connection of yagep-kahip = redis://giliel_svc:zYiKsLL2PLpfPL@db-348f.xolmarsys.corp:5432/fenwyn

Joint Venture Proposal — Restricted: Managers Only

This page summarises the proposed joint venture between Ostrand Materials and Kivela Polymer Works to co-develop coated packaging films. Ownership would be split 55/45, with a jointly staffed plant near Dunmarrow. Due diligence concludes next quarter; the board votes thereafter. Financial models are attached below. Before reviewing the figures, please read the following note carefully.

board note of hafog-kafop: Only 50 of the 505 pilot accounts renewed Eliys, so a churn review is set for April 7. Fravanox Partners is in early talks to buy Tamvanix Logistics for about $273.9 million.